The mythological account of Garuda’s birth in the Mahabharata identifies him as the younger … how i got rid of my frecklesWebThe people of the Cochiti tribe believed bluebirds to be closely associated with the sun. This is because every morning, these birds woke the people of the tribe early enough to witness the beauty of the rising sun. There are also stories about two bluebirds being the contributors to the creation of the rainbow. Spring, Summer, Autumn, Winter. high gloss black table topWebRavens are considered a solar symbol in Chinese mythology. The three legged raven lives in the sun, representing the sun’s three phases – rising, noon and setting. When the sunlight hits their glossy black feathers just … how i got rid of love handles
